MACK A. GENTRY  
  Mack Gentry founded the firm in 1976. He is a native of Knoxville and a 1966 graduate of the University of Tennessee, where he played and coached football for the Volunteers and was an Academic All-American. Mr. Gentry graduated from the University of Tennessee College of Law in 1968 and later served as an officer in the United States Army. He holds an advanced LL.M. degree in Taxation from New York University and is a John Lyons Certified Horse Trainer.

In addition, Mr. Gentry is listed in The Best Lawyers in America and Who's Who in American Law.

Mr. Gentry has been admitted to practice law in all Tennessee courts, all Colorado courts, the U.S. District Court for the Eastern District of Tennessee, the U.S. Tax Court, the U.S. Claims Court, the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Sixth Circuit and the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it.  He is a member of the Knoxville and Tennessee Bar Associations.
